-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 Gentoo Linux Security Advisory GLSA 200403-02 ~ https://security.gentoo.org/
~ Severity: High ~ Title: Linux kernel do_mremap local privilege escalation ~ vulnerability ~ Date: March 06, 2004 ~ Bugs: #42024 ~ ID: 200403-02
Synopsis ======= A critical security vulnerability has been found in recent Linux kernels by Paul Starzetz of iSEC Security Research which allows for local privilege escalations.
Background ========= The Linux kernel is responsible for memory management in a working system - to allow this, processes are allowed to allocate and unallocate memory.
